맨위로가기

저항-트랜지스터 논리

"오늘의AI위키"는 AI 기술로 일관성 있고 체계적인 최신 지식을 제공하는 혁신 플랫폼입니다.
"오늘의AI위키"의 AI를 통해 더욱 풍부하고 폭넓은 지식 경험을 누리세요.

1. 개요

저항-트랜지스터 논리(RTL)는 저항과 트랜지스터를 사용하여 논리 게이트를 구현하는 전자 회로의 한 종류이다. 가장 기본적인 RTL 게이트는 인버터이며, 여기에 베이스 저항을 추가하여 NOR 게이트를 만들 수 있다. RTL은 트랜지스터 수를 최소화할 수 있다는 장점이 있지만, 전력 소비가 크고 팬인이 제한적이라는 단점이 있다. 초기 RTL의 속도 문제를 개선하기 위해 저항에 커패시터를 추가하는 RCTL 등의 다양한 기술이 사용되었다.

더 읽어볼만한 페이지

  • 논리 계열 - CMOS
    CMOS는 상보적 금속 산화막 반도체의 약자로, 저전력 소비를 특징으로 하며, P형과 N형 MOSFET을 결합하여 논리 게이트를 구현하는 디지털 회로 설계 방식 및 공정 계열이다.
  • 논리 계열 - 트랜지스터-트랜지스터 논리
    트랜지스터-트랜지스터 논리(TTL)는 1961년 제임스 L. 부이에 의해 발명된 바이폴라 접합 트랜지스터 기반의 디지털 회로 기술로, 텍사스 인스트루먼츠의 7400 시리즈를 통해 널리 사용되었으며, 저렴한 비용으로 디지털 기술 발전에 기여했다.
  • 집적 회로 - 실시간 시계
    실시간 시계(RTC)는 CPU 개입 없이 독립적으로 시간을 유지하며, 저전력 소비와 시간 민감 작업의 부담 감소, 절전 모드 유지를 위해 디지털 카운터 회로, 결정 진동자, 배터리 등으로 구성되어 PC 메인보드에 부착되거나 사우스브리지 칩 또는 마이크로컨트롤러에 내장된다.
  • 집적 회로 - NMOS 논리
    NMOS 논리는 n형 MOSFET만을 사용하여 논리 게이트를 구현하는 방식으로, 저항을 부하로 사용하여 NOR 게이트 등을 구현할 수 있지만, Low에서 High로의 전환 속도가 느리고 전력 소비가 높아 CMOS 논리에 밀려 현재는 제한적으로 사용된다.
저항-트랜지스터 논리
기본 정보
저항-트랜지스터 논리 NOR 게이트
저항-트랜지스터 논리 회로도
유형디지털 회로
응용 분야논리 게이트
구성 요소저항
트랜지스터
발명1950년대 후반
선행 기술다이오드-트랜지스터 논리 (DTL)
후속 기술트랜지스터-트랜지스터 논리 (TTL)
특징
속도느림
전력 소모높음
팬아웃낮음
노이즈 마진낮음
복잡성간단함
비용저렴함
기타
장점간단한 설계, 저렴한 비용
단점낮은 속도, 높은 전력 소모, 낮은 팬아웃, 낮은 노이즈 마진
용도초기 집적 회로, 교육용

2. 구현

RTL은 저항과 트랜지스터를 사용하여 기본적인 논리 게이트를 구현한다.

가장 기본적인 RTL 게이트(NOT 게이트)는 베이스 저항과 컬렉터 저항을 가진 공통 이미터 트랜지스터 스위치로 구성된다.[20] 하나 이상의 베이스 저항을 가진 NOT 게이트는 RTL NOR 게이트가 된다.[21]

단일 트랜지스터 RTL NOR 게이트의 단점은 병렬 연결된 트랜지스터 스위치가 논리 입력을 연결하는 다중 트랜지스터 RTL로 보완할 수 있다.[4] 이 방식은 이후 DCTL, ECL, TTL 일부 (7450, 7460), NMOSCMOS 게이트를 만드는 데 사용되었다.

2. 1. RTL NOT 게이트 (RTL 인버터)

단일 트랜지스터 RTL NOR 게이트의 회로도.


가장 기본적인 RTL 게이트(NOT 게이트)는 베이스 저항과 컬렉터 저항을 가진 공통 이미터 트랜지스터 스위치로 구성된다.[20] 베이스 저항은 입력 전압을 전류로 변환하고, 논리 "1" 레벨(약 3.5V)을 정의하는 데 중요한 역할을 한다. 매우 작은 트랜지스터 입력 전압(약 0.7V)을 논리적 "1" 수준으로 끌어올리기 위해 존재하며, 트랜지스터를 충족시킬 만큼 충분히 낮으면서도 높은 입력 저항값을 얻을 만큼 높은 값으로 조정된다. 컬렉터 저항은 컬렉터 전류를 전압으로 변환하고, 출력 저항(높은 팬아웃)을 결정하며, 트랜지스터를 충족시킬 만큼 충분히 높으면서도 낮은 출력 저항값을 얻을 만큼 낮은 값으로 설정된다.

2. 2. 단일 트랜지스터 RTL NOR 게이트

하나 이상의 베이스 저항(R3, R4)을 가진 NOT 게이트는 RTL NOR 게이트가 된다.[21] OR 연산은 덧셈비교라는 두 가지 산술 연산을 통해 이루어진다. 입력 저항들은 동일한 가중치를 가지는 병렬 ''전압 가산기''처럼 동작하고, 공통 이미터 트랜지스터는 약 0.7V를 임계치로 가지는 ''전압 비교기''처럼 동작한다.[3]

논리 "1"에 연결된 저항과 논리 "0"에 연결된 저항은 트랜지스터로 구성된 전압 분배기의 두 다리 역할을 한다. 베이스 저항의 저항값과 입력 개수는 하나의 논리 "1"이 베이스-이미터 전압을 임계치 이상으로 만들어 트랜지스터를 작동시킬 수 있도록 제한적으로 결정된다. 모든 입력 전압이 낮으면(논리 "0") 트랜지스터는 전류가 차단된다. 풀다운 저항 R1은 트랜지스터가 꺼짐과 켜짐을 적절하게 구분하도록 돕는다. 트랜지스터 Q1의 컬렉터-이미터 전압을 출력으로 사용하면 입력이 낮을 때 출력이 높아지므로, 출력은 부정된다. 이와 같이 아날로그 저항 회로와 아날로그 트랜지스터는 NOR 논리 회로를 구성한다.[11] 이러한 구성(가중 입력 그룹의 가산 회로로 스위치를 구동)을 "임계값 논리 게이트"(threshold logic gates)라고 부른다.[12]

2. 3. 다중 트랜지스터 RTL NOR 게이트

단일 트랜지스터 RTL NOR 게이트의 단점은 다중 트랜지스터 RTL로 보완할 수 있다. 다중 트랜지스터 RTL은 병렬 연결된 트랜지스터 스위치가 논리 입력을 연결한다(오른쪽 그림 참고). 이 구성에서 입력은 완전히 분리되어 있으며, 입력 개수의 제한은 차단 트랜지스터의 작은 전류 누수값이 논리적 "1"의 출력에 미치는 영향에 의존한다.[4] 이 아이디어는 이후 DCTL, ECL, TTL 일부 (7450, 7460), NMOSCMOS 게이트를 만들 때 사용되었다.

300px


아폴로 유도 컴퓨터를 구축하는 데 사용된 듀얼 3-입력 NOR 게이트 칩 사진. 연결부(중앙 상단에서 시계 방향): 접지, 입력(3개), 출력, 전원(Vcc), 출력, 입력(3개). 6개의 트랜지스터(3개의 그룹 2개)가 중앙에 있다. 단자에서 트랜지스터로 연결되는 가는 전선은 저항기이다.


플랫팩 RTL NOR 게이트 집적 회로가 아폴로 유도 컴퓨터에 탑재됨

3. 장점

RTL의 가장 큰 장점은 트랜지스터 수를 최소화할 수 있다는 점이다.[23][5][14] 집적 회로 이전 시대에는 트랜지스터가 가장 비싼 부품이었기 때문에 이는 중요한 장점이었다.[23][5][14] 1961년 페어차일드 제품과 같은 초기 IC 논리 제품도 같은 방법을 사용했지만,[23][5] 집적 회로에서 다이오드와 트랜지스터가 더 이상 저항보다 비싸지 않게 되면서, 다이오드-트랜지스터 논리[23][5]트랜지스터-트랜지스터 논리(1963년 실바니아 일렉트릭 프로덕츠에서 시작)[5]와 같은 고성능 회로로 빠르게 전환되었다.

4. 단점

트랜지스터가 켜져 있을 때 베이스 저항과 컬렉터 저항을 통해 전류가 흘러 전력 소비가 크다. 이 때문에 RTL 회로에 더 많은 전류를 공급하고 발생한 열을 제거해야 한다. 반면, "토템폴" 출력 상태의 TTL 회로는 이러한 요건들을 최소화한다.[24]

팬인이 제한적이라는 단점도 있다. 많은 회로 설계에서 잡음 내성을 유지할 수 있는 입력 개수는 3개가 한계이다. 즉, 잡음 여유가 낮다. 랭카스터는 입력 당 트랜지스터 1개를 가지는 집적 RTL NOR 게이트는 "어떤 개수의" 논리적 입력으로든지 만들 수 있다고 말하며, 8입력 NOR 게이트의 예시를 보였다.[24]

표준 집적 RTL NOR 게이트는 입력을 최대 3개까지 가질 수 있다. 그 대신에, 최대 2개의 표준 집적 RTL "버퍼"를 작동시킬 수 있는 충분한 출력을 가지고 있으며, 각각의 버퍼는 또한 25개의 다른 표준 RTL NOR 게이트를 작동시킬 수 있다.[24]

5. 속도 향상 (RCTL)

초기 RTL의 속도 문제를 개선하기 위해 다음과 같은 다양한 방법이 사용되었다.


  • RCTL (저항-커패시터-트랜지스터 논리): 입력 저항에 병렬로 커패시터를 추가하여 구동 스테이지가 베이스-이미터 접합을 순방향 바이어스하는 데 필요한 시간을 줄였다. 링컨 연구소의 TX-0 컴퓨터 회로에 일부 RCTL이 사용되었다.[8][17]
  • 고주파 트랜지스터 사용: ''GE 트랜지스터 매뉴얼''에서는 더 높은 주파수의 트랜지스터를 사용하여 속도를 높일 것을 권장한다.[7][16]
  • 베이커 클램프: 베이스에서 컬렉터로 다이오드를 연결(병렬 음성 피드백)하여 트랜지스터의 포화를 방지하고 속도를 높이는 방법이다.[7] 다이오드와 저항, 게르마늄과 실리콘 다이오드, 또는 세 개의 다이오드를 음성 피드백 형태로 사용하여 컬렉터가 포화에 가까워짐에 따라 베이스에 가해지는 전압을 감소시켰다.[16]
  • 컬렉터 전압 조정 및 다이오드 클램핑: 높은 컬렉터 공급 전압과 다이오드 클램핑을 사용하여 컬렉터-베이스 및 배선 커패시턴스 충전 시간을 감소시켰다. 이 방법은 다이오드-트랜지스터 논리(DTL)에도 적용되었다.[9][18]


이러한 기술적 발전은 훗날 대한민국이 반도체 강국으로 발돋움하는 데 기술적인 기반이 되었다.

참조

[1] 서적 Computers in Spaceflight: The NASA Experience https://history.nasa[...] NASA History Division 1987
[2] 웹사이트 Resistor-Transistor Logic http://www.play-hook[...] 2018-10-02
[3] 서적 Transistor Component Circuits http://ibm-1401.info[...] IBM 2010-01-04
[4] 문서 Apollo Guidance Computer schematics http://klabs.org/his[...]
[5] 서적 Electronics: The Life Story of a Technology https://books.google[...] JHU Press
[6] 서적 RTL cookbook http://www.alibris.c[...] Bobbs-Merrill Co. (or Howard W Sams)
[7] 서적 "GE Transistor Manual" General Electric, Semiconductor Products Department, Syracuse, NY
[8] 서적 TX0 Computer Circuitry http://bitsavers.org[...] MIT Lincoln Laboratory 2011-09-09
[9] 서적 The Digital Logic Handbook Flip Chip Modules http://www.bitsavers[...] Digital Equipment Corporation 2008-03-08
[10] 웹사이트 Resistor-Transistor Logic http://www.play-hook[...]
[11] 웹사이트 Form 223-6889-Transistor Component Circuits http://ibm-1401.info[...] IBM 2010-01-04
[12] 간행물 Threshold Logic Mills & Boon Ltd.
[13] 문서 Apollo Guidance Computer schematics http://klabs.org/his[...]
[14] 서적 Electronics: The Life Story of a Technology https://books.google[...] JHU Press
[15] 서적 RTL cookbook http://www.alibris.c[...] Bobbs-Merrill Co. (or Howard W Sams)
[16] 서적 "GE Transistor Manual" General Electric, Semiconductor Products Department, Syracuse, NY
[17] 서적 TX0 Computer Circuitry http://www.bitsavers[...] MIT Lincoln Laboratory 2008-03-04
[18] 서적 The Digital Logic Handbook http://www.bitsavers[...] Digital Equipment Corporation 2008-03-08
[19] 웹사이트 https://history.nasa[...]
[20] 웹사이트 Resistor-Transistor Logic http://www.play-hook[...] 2018-10-02
[21] 서적 Transistor Component Circuits http://ibm-1401.info[...] IBM 2010-01-04
[22] 문서 Apollo Guidance Computer schematics http://klabs.org/his[...]
[23] 서적 Electronics: The Life Story of a Technology https://books.google[...] JHU Press
[24] 서적 RTL cookbook http://www.alibris.c[...] Bobbs-Merrill Co. (or Howard W Sams)



본 사이트는 AI가 위키백과와 뉴스 기사,정부 간행물,학술 논문등을 바탕으로 정보를 가공하여 제공하는 백과사전형 서비스입니다.
모든 문서는 AI에 의해 자동 생성되며, CC BY-SA 4.0 라이선스에 따라 이용할 수 있습니다.
하지만, 위키백과나 뉴스 기사 자체에 오류, 부정확한 정보, 또는 가짜 뉴스가 포함될 수 있으며, AI는 이러한 내용을 완벽하게 걸러내지 못할 수 있습니다.
따라서 제공되는 정보에 일부 오류나 편향이 있을 수 있으므로, 중요한 정보는 반드시 다른 출처를 통해 교차 검증하시기 바랍니다.

문의하기 : help@durumis.com